Builers' Sales & Service Company was founded in 1958 by
Rupert Allen Pridemore. He grew the business and quickly
became the largest distributor of built-in appliances in Tarrant
County.
He was one of the most recognizable names in the industry and
was one of Fort Worth's most respected businessmen. Rupe was
known nationally by the major manufacturers for his
achievements. The manufacturers repeatedly presesented him
with "Top Distributor" awards and used his company as a model for
other similar distributors. He has strong ties with the
manufacturers, customers, and associates with whom he was involved.
Those knowing him best knew how much he loved his own company
and the Greater Fort Worth Builderr Association (GFWBA).
Tireless energy, effort and time was poured into both of these
endeavors.
The GFWBA elected Rupe countless times to serve as associate
vice presiden to chair various committees. His favorite even
was Associate Night. He always felt that the associates
represented a very important part of the association and wanted
them recognizes for their overall impact on its success.
Initially, the Builders Association used a "one-time-only"
presentation of the Associate of the Year Award, but Rupe was
recgnized three times. The association suprised him at the
Annual Ceremony of Excellence Awards Dinner in December 2002 by
presenting the first "Rupert Pridemore Associate of the Year
Award."
Having that award bear his name was certainly an honor that
touched his heart. Also, at the September 28, 2001, meeting
held at the Fort Worth Club, the Association suprised Rupe by
making him the first and only associate to ever become an Honorary
Life Director of the Greater Fort Worth Builders Association.
These two unique tributes were both valued and cherished by hime.
